Stefan Trobro is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Genetics and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Stefan Trobro has authored 11 papers receiving a total of 611 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Molecular Biology, 4 papers in Genetics and 2 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Stefan Trobro’s work include R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(9 papers), RNA modifications and cancer (7 papers) and Bacterial Genetics and Biotechnology (4 papers). Stefan Trobro is often cited by papers focused on R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(9 papers), RNA modifications and cancer (7 papers) and Bacterial Genetics and Biotechnology (4 papers). Stefan Trobro coll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, United States and France. Stefan Trobro's co-authors include Johan Åqvist, Leif A. Kirsebom, Måns Ehrenberg, Michael Y. Pavlov, Magnus Johansson, Peter Strazewski, Jerry Ståhlberg, Johanna Blomqvist, Mats Sandgren and Volkmar Passoth and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nucleic Acids Research and Molecular Cell.
